The MPLAD6.5KP15CAE3 belongs to the category of transient voltage suppressor (TVS) diodes.
It is used to protect sensitive electronic components from voltage transients induced by lightning, electrostatic discharge (ESD), and other transient voltage events.
The MPLAD6.5KP15CAE3 is available in a DO-201AD package.
The essence of this product lies in its ability to provide robust protection against transient voltage events, thereby safeguarding electronic circuits and components.
The MPLAD6.5KP15CAE3 is typically packaged in reels or tubes and is available in varying quantities based on customer requirements.
The MPLAD6.5KP15CAE3 TVS diode has a standard two-pin configuration with anode and cathode terminals.
The MPLAD6.5KP15CAE3 operates by diverting excessive transient currents away from the protected circuit, thereby limiting the voltage across the circuit to a safe level.
The MPLAD6.5KP15CAE3 is commonly used in various applications including: - Telecommunication equipment - Industrial control systems - Automotive electronics - Power supplies - Consumer electronics
